What Bedford code requires
Installing or replacing an HVAC system in Bedford follows Texas rules under the state mechanical code. Here’s what applies statewide:
- PermitRequired
Mechanical permit pulled by your licensed HVAC contractor; covers equipment, refrigerant, and the electrical disconnect.
- SEER2 minimum14.3 SEER2 (Southeast, <45k BTU)
Federal Southeast-region minimum for new split-system AC. Higher tiers cut bills and unlock rebates.
- Load calculationRecommended
Sizing by load calc — not rule of thumb — prevents an oversized unit that short-cycles and never dehumidifies.
- RefrigerantR-454B / R-32 (R-410A phased down 2025+)
- Good to know—
HVAC work must be done by a TDLR-licensed Air Conditioning & Refrigeration contractor, and the licensed contractor (not the homeowner) pulls the required mechanical permit.

AC Maintenance in Bedford, explained.
What affects AC tune-up cost in Bedford?
Prices vary based on system age (1980s homes may need extra cleaning), coil cleaning ($95–$375), and whether you choose a single tune-up or an annual plan. Labor rates reflect licensed contractor costs and permit fees. Seasonal demand in hot months can also influence pricing.
Common AC issues found during tune-ups
Dirty evaporator coil
Older systems often have dust buildup, reducing efficiency and airflow.
Refrigerant leaks
With R-410A phasing down, leaks in older units may require repair or upgrade to R-454B/R-32.
Faulty capacitor or contactor
Worn electrical parts can cause the AC to fail to start or cycle improperly.
